About

Mateo Stavridis is a synthwave musician based in Turin, Italy. With a career spanning over 16 years, their sound blends synthwave with electronic ambient influences, creating a distinctive sonic palette that has been described as "deeply atmospheric and emotionally resonant."

Their latest work continues to push the boundaries of synthwave, incorporating elements of post-punk revival and field recordings from Ljubljana, Slovenia.
